    The Indian food thread got me thinking. I like Indian food, but I LOVE Thai food. We have a friend who spent quite a bit of time in Holland and really got to appreciate Indonesian food. I've got another friend who's been to Indonesia, and he liked the food and described it as being influenced by both Indians and Thais.

    I'd like to give it a try. b4-u-eat talks about two places in Houston...Bali Grill and Mata Hari. It looks like Mata Hari is hit or miss, and Bali Grill only has one review....albeit a good one.

    Any suggestions? Does anyone have an experience with the food? Does anyone know of any other Indonesian restaurants in Houston? What should I order the first time? My wife and I are both suckers for any food that makes your eyes water and your nose run, so we'll probably want something spicy.
